Output 50de53b64a6af5233fd872c5a3237c397719aa5573c570f4ad7e1930f19c14b8:12

value
77659826
script pubkey
OP_0 OP_PUSHBYTES_20 bbb86b1c1f6a91a71f371b6237899c2c3a35df0d
address
ltc1qhwuxk8qld2g6w8ehrd3r0zvu9sarthcddcjcah
transaction
50de53b64a6af5233fd872c5a3237c397719aa5573c570f4ad7e1930f19c14b8
spent
true